On Thursday 4th April, The Michelin Guide Malta announced that ION Harbour by Simon Rogan had become the first and only restaurant on the island to receive two Michelin stars.
This prestigious two Michelin star award for ION Harbour comes just one year after Simon Rogan took the helm, adding to the six other Michelin stars his restaurants hold worldwide:
L’Enclume ***, Rogan & Co *, Aulis London *, Roganic Hong Kong *, as well as a Michelin Green star at L’Enclume and Roganic Hong Kong in recognition of their efforts towards sustainability.
ION Harbour received its first Michelin star less than six months after opening its doors in November 2020 and retained its one-Michelin star status every year since. Since taking over stewardship of ION Harbour in March 2023, Simon, alongside executive chef Oli Marlow, has made it his mission to share and adapt his renowned farm-to-table ethos, perfected at L’Enclume, in the Lake District, UK. The menu at ION Harbour is strongly guided by hyperlocal, seasonal ingredients that are harvested, fished and foraged by the best, ethical and sustainable local producers. From the moment ingredients are sourced to the final presentation on the plate, every aspect of the restaurant’s operations reflects their deep-rooted ethos of environmental responsibility and ethical sourcing.
